a { color:#5D5D9E; } 
a:visited { color:#5D5D9E; } 
a:active { color:#5C615E; } 
a:hover { color:#B2B3B4; } 
		a.wsp4855a03{ color:#FFFFFF; text-decoration: underline} 
		a.wsp4855a03:visited{ color:#FFFFFF; text-decoration: underline} 
		a.wsp4855a03:active{ color:#FFFFFF; text-decoration: none} 
		a.wsp4855a03:hover{ color:#FFFFFF; text-decoration: underline} 
#menu_4e6f07ae a { text-decoration: none; }
#menu_4e6f07ae_pane { background-color: #FFFFFF; border: 1px solid #FFFFFF; padding-top: 10px; padding-bottom: 10px; box-shadow: 2px 2px 6px 0px rgba(8, 8, 8, 0.784314); }
#menu_4e6f07ae_hr { background-color: #FFFFFF; height: 1px; border: none; }
#menu_4e6f07ae_entry { padding-left: 10px; padding-right: 10px; padding-top: 3px; padding-bottom: 3px; }
#menu_4e6f07ae_entry:hover { background-color: #323232; color: #FFFFFF !important; }
#menu_4e6f07ae_entry:hover span { color:#FFFFFF !important; }
		.menu_4e6f07ae_mainMenuEntry { text-align: center; }
		.menu_4e6f07ae_mainMenuEntry:hover {	background-color:#282828; }
		.menu_4e6f07ae_mainMenuEntry:hover span {	color:#FFFFFF !important; }
		#menu_4e6f07ae .mobileEntry { display: none; } 
		#menu_4e6f07ae .normalEntry { display: block; } 
	/*	@media only screen and (max-width:600px) { 
			#menu_4e6f07ae .mobileEntry { display: block; } 
			#menu_4e6f07ae .normalEntry { display: none; } */
		}
body { background-color:#FFFFFF; padding:0;  margin: 0; }
.textstyle1 { text-align:left; }
#menu_4e6f07ae { box-sizing: border-box; vertical-align: bottom; position:relative; display: inline-block; width:100%; height:38px; text-align:left; background-color:#FFFFFF; background: linear-gradient(to bottom, #FFFFFF, #FFFFFF); border: 1px solid #FFFFFF;  }
.menuholder1 { position: relative; overflow: hidden; width: 100%; height: 100%; }
.menustyle1 { position:absolute; width:37px; height:38px; left:10px;  }
.menuentry_text1 { position:absolute; top:0px; bottom:0px; left:0px; right:0px; margin-top:auto; margin-bottom:auto; margin-left:auto; margin-right:auto; height:33px;  }
.textstyle2 { font-size:22pt; font-family:Arial, Helvetica, sans-serif; color:#000000;  white-space: nowrap; }
.menustyle2 { position:absolute; width:30px; height:38px; left:10px;  }
.menuentry_text2 { position:absolute; top:0px; bottom:0px; left:0px; right:0px; margin-top:auto; margin-bottom:auto; margin-left:auto; margin-right:auto; height:0px;  }
.menustyle3 { position:absolute; width:70px; height:38px; left:40px;  }
.menuentry_text3 { position:absolute; top:0px; bottom:0px; left:0px; right:0px; margin-top:auto; margin-bottom:auto; margin-left:auto; margin-right:auto; height:19px;  }
.textstyle3 { font-size:12pt; font-family:'DejaVu Sans'; color:#000000;  white-space: nowrap; }
.textstyle4 { font-size:12pt; font-family:Arial, Helvetica, sans-serif; color:#000000;  white-space: nowrap; }
.textstyle5 { text-align:center; }
.textstyle6 { font-size:20pt; font-family:'DejaVu Sans'; color:#000000;  }
.textstyle7 { font-size:12pt; font-family:'DejaVu Sans'; color:#000000;  }
.textstyle8 { font-size:10pt; font-family:'DejaVu Sans'; color:#000000;  }

/* Mobile-Menü nach oben öffnen */
@media only screen and (max-width:700px) {
    #menu_52d50cb9 {
        position: relative !important;
        z-index: 9999 !important;
        width: 100% !important;
    }

    /* Mobile Entries starten unsichtbar, JS zeigt sie */
    #menu_52d50cb9 .mobileEntry {
        position: absolute !important;
        bottom: 100%; /* Dropdown über dem Button */
        left: 0;
        width: 100%;
        background-color: #FFFFFF;
        box-shadow: 0 -2px 6px rgba(0,0,0,0.3);
        z-index: 9999;
    }

    /* Wenn Toggle aktiv (RocketCake) */
    #menu_52d50cb9 .mobileEntry.show {
        display: block !important;
    }

    /* Touchfreundliche Einträge */
    #menu_52d50cb9_entry {
        padding: 15px 10px !important;
    }
}
